Job overview

Hereford County Hospital is a busy district general hospital serving the population of Herefordshire, Powys and parts of Shropshire. We currently have vacancies within our team in Radiology. Are you newly qualified or due to qualify Summer 26? Or are you looking for a new challenge?

Come and join our friendly team, we are happy to discuss flexible ways of working.

The Radiology department in Hereford has undergone significant changes over the last 5 years since entering into a partnership with Philips and you will have the opportunity to work with up to date technology, in 2021 we opened a  new interventional suite, new MRI scanners and our third CT scanner.

This post offers an exciting opportunity to contribute to the delivery of our Community Diagnostic Centre (CDC), due to open in  the Summer of 2025 in Hereford.

The Community Diagnostic Centre will incorporate Imaging (Plain X-ray, ultrasound, CT and MRI), a range of cardiorespiratory investigations  and pathology services in a "one stop" location to obtain diagnostic information.   Community Diagnostic Centre

Successful candidates will work at the Hereford County Hospital site initially and then in rotation between the hospital site and our CDC site which opened in 2025.

Prospective candidates are welcome to have an informal discussion with Mrs Leah Hughes (Operational Clinical Lead Radiographer) on 01432 364450

Main duties of the job

The successful candidates will be expected to have B.Sc Diagnostic Radiography or equivalent qualifications or due to qualify in Summer 2026. Our band 5 rotation will include rotation into CT, general x-ray, theatres and mobiles  and working towards cannulation certification within the first 6 months. We are a busy department and there is a requirement for applicants to participate in our 24/7 shift system as well as weekend on call for theatre.

The post holder will be expected to produce imaging to the highest standards, offer training and support for diagnostic radiography students from BCU, University of Gloucester and University of Worcester.
